When we talk about puberty, we are talking about the beginning of a lifelong journey in relating to others. Key pillars of this education include: 1. Communication Skills

For generations, puberty education focused strictly on anatomy, hygiene, and reproduction. While these foundational facts remain essential, they represent only half of the adolescent experience.

Adolescents need explicit instruction on how to identify, label, and communicate their feelings. This includes learning how to express romantic interest honestly and respectfully, as well as how to communicate boundaries. Education should focus on "I-statements" and active listening, giving youth the tools to advocate for their own emotional needs while respecting those of their peers. 2. As children enter the critical phase of puberty, they face a multitude of physical, emotional, and psychological changes that can be both exciting and overwhelming. It is during this period that they require accurate, age-appropriate information about their developing bodies, relationships, and sexuality. Puberty sexual education for boys and girls is essential to ensure they navigate this significant life transition with confidence, respect, and a strong foundation for healthy relationships.
